In regard to evil, be infants, but in your thinking, be adults.” II Peter 3:1 “I have written to you … to stimulate wholesome thinking.” Thinking like an adult may well involve training your brain to think differently and to undo some fault-filled habits in the way you process incoming … Web2 jul. 2024 · The following tips can help you curb negative thoughts and strengthen your relationship with yourself. 1. Be aware of your thoughts. Start by familiarizing yourself with common cognitive distortions. Practice identifying and labeling your negative thoughts so that you start to recognize your negative thinking patterns.
